The Minister of State for Defence, Musiliu Obanikoro has said that the Government of Nigeria is committed to the fight against HIV/AIDS scourge in Nigeria. He made the statement while addressing the Site/Team Commanders of the Nigerian Ministry of Defence / United States Department of Defense (NMOD-USDOD) HIV delegates conference at the Emergency Plan Implementation Committee (EPIC) Liaison Office, Abuja.
Musiliu Obanikoro commended the United States Government for partnering with Nigeria in the fight against HIV/AIDS tracing the commencement of the NMOD-USDOD programme to the era of President George W. Bush. He also said that Nigeria can overcome the problem of HIV/AIDS within the context of President Jonathan’s Transformation Agenda which also focuses on health. Adding, Government is fully committed to funding the project.
He advised the Armed Forces to extend the activities of the programme to civilians and lauded the efforts of O. S Njoku (Major Gen) who was a pioneer staff of the project.
Speaking earlier, the Ministry of Defence EPIC Chairman, T. O Umar (Major Gen) said that HIV/AIDS is a major public health issue and the virus is one of the leading causes of death in the Sub-Saharan Africa. He further noted that in 2005, the Nigerian and United States Governments established a partnership through the NMOD-USDOD HIV programme towards combating the spread of HIV/AIDS. The programme he said started with four sites and presently has forty-six sites. He added that the programme which engages in clinical research to combat HIV extends to other African countries.
According to him, the programme is working to achieve ownership and sustainability through counterpart funding from the Nigerian Government.
In a remark at the occasion, the Head of the USDOD Water Reed programme in Nigeria, Robbie Nelson said that Nigeria is not just a recipient of research findings, but a contributor and participant.
